In 1911 they had three more children and all seven were in the house together with their parents, though Fanny did report that she had had 10 children of whom three had died, at 5 Brick Kiln Row Tunstall Stoke in Trent, Tunstall, Staffordshire:

First name(s)  Last name  Relationship  Marital status  Sex  Age  Birth year  Occupation  Birth place
Albert   Gater  Head  M  M  46  1865  House painter         Tunstall Staff
Fanny    Gater  Wife  M  F  42  1869  -                     Burslem Staff
Henry    Gater  Son   S  M  20  1891  House painter         Tunstall Staff
Lilly    Gater  Daur  S  F  14  1897  Tile factory fettler  Tunstall Staff
Minnie   Gater  Daur  -  F  12  1899  School                Tunstall Staff
Albert   Gater  Son   -  M  10  1901  School                Tunstall Staff
Earnest  Gater  Son   -  M   5  1906  -                     Tunstall Staff
Horace   Gater  Son   -  M   3  1908  -                     Tunstall Staff
Fanny    Gater  Daur  -  F   1  1910  -                     Tunstall Staff

1911 ref: RG14 PN16474 RG78 PN1020 RD360 SD2 ED18 SN219

One missing…

I have been through the GRO again and this time allowed it to search all UK, not just Wolstanton.  It made no difference, still only 10 in total including Frederick who appeared after the 1911 census.

An answer might be that one of the births just was not registered.

It might be worth seeing if any baptisms are on record.  None found.

What did FindMyPast get wrong to have left out two people?  They left out Arthur and Ernest.
For Arthur Gater there are two registrations, one in Wolstanton in 1903 and one in Stoke on Trent in 1904; neither have the mother’s maiden name.  Curiously there are also two registrations the same for Arthur Rowe.
For Ernest Gater there are three registrations, one in Wolstanton in 1902, one again in Wolstanton in 1904 and an Ernest James in Stoke on Trent in 1903.  All three have no mother’s maiden name.  There are no parallel Rowe registrations.  There are three Gater registrations in Wolstanton from 1902 to 1904:
  Ernest in 1902, mother  = Johnson,
  Ernest in 1904, mother  = Bailey,
  ‘blank’ in 1904, mother = Harris.
There are, in fact, 31 Gater registration between 1901 and 1905.  I think I am chasing my tail on this one.

All I can find for Fanny’s children are 10 registered births up to the last in 1914.  So that is her score.

Notes for Albert & Fanny (Family)
The image of the marriage register is available on FindMyPast, transcript by me:

“                            Page 130
“1889. Marriage solemnized at S. Mary’s Church in the Parish of Tunstall in the County of Stafford.
“No:            259
“When Married:  22nd July 1889

                    His              Hers
“Name:            Albert Gater    Fanny Rowe
“Age:             24              20
“Condition:       Bachelor        Spinster
“Profession:      House Painter   -
“Residence:       7 Lime St.      8 Heath St. Burslem
“Father’s name:   Henry Gater     George Rowe
“Father’s job:    House Painter   Fireman

“Married in the S. Mary’s Church according to the Rites and Ceremonies of the Established Church
“  after Banns by me  Percy Stowers(?)
“This Marriage was solemnized between us,  Albert Gater  Fanny Rowe
“In the Presence of us,  William Parry,  Alice Smallwood
